Other Superfood (Sea Cucumbers are superfoods!)

There’s no official scientific definition of a superfood, but it’s generally accepted that superfoods contain high levels of much-needed vitamins and minerals. They can also be a source of antioxidants, substances that shield our bodies from cell damage and help prevent disease. We offer superfoods that are not easy to find, and we always source the best.